package main
import (
"log"
"net/url"
"sort"
"strings"
"sync"
"time"
"github.com/ChimeraCoder/anaconda"
)
const (
// Create an app from https://apps.twitter.com/, create an access token
// and copy-paste the values from there.
CONSUMER_KEY = "_REPLACE_THIS_"
CONSUMER_SECRET = "_REPLACE_THIS_"
ACCESS_TOKEN = "_REPLACE_THIS_"
ACCESS_TOKEN_SECRET = "_REPLACE_THIS_"
// The interface and port the web server should listen on.
LISTEN_ADDRESS = "0.0.0.0:8080"
)
// Info from one twitter account.
type TwitterInfo struct {
Name string
Image string
Followers int
Tweets int64
Democrat bool
}
// Stats about all candidates.
type Stats struct {
sync.Mutex
At time.Time
Twitter []TwitterInfo
}
func (s *Stats) Put(t []TwitterInfo) {
s.Lock()
defer s.Unlock()
s.At = time.Now().In(TZ_ET)
s.Twitter = t
}
func (s *Stats) Get() (time.Time, []TwitterInfo) {
s.Lock()
defer s.Unlock()
return s.At, s.Twitter
}
// This is uh, how you sort in Go..
type ByFollowers []TwitterInfo
func (a ByFollowers) Len() int { return len(a) }
func (a ByFollowers) Swap(i, j int) { a[i], a[j] = a[j], a[i] }
func (a ByFollowers) Less(i, j int) bool { return a[i].Followers > a[j].Followers }
var stats = &Stats{}
var TZ_ET *time.Location
var democrats = []string{
"LincolnChafee", // Lincoln Chafee
"HillaryClinton", // Hillary Clinton
"MartinOMalley", // Martin O'Malley
"BernieSanders", // Bernie Sanders
"JimWebbUSA", // Jim Webb
}
var republicans = []string{
"JebBush", // Jeb Bush
"realbencarson", // Dr. Ben Carson
"ChrisChristie", // Chris Christie
"tedcruz", // Ted Cruz
"CarlyFiorina", // Clary Fiorina
"gov_gilmore", // James Gilmore
"LindseyGrahamSC", // Lindsey Graham
"GovMikeHuckabee", // Mike Huckabee
"BobbyJindal", // Bobby Jindal
"JohnKasich", // John Kasich
"GovernorPataki", // George Pataki
"RandPaul", // Dr. Rand Paul
"marcorubio", // Marco Rubio
"RickSantorum", // Rick Santorum
"realDonaldTrump", // Donald Trump
"ScottWalker", // Scott Walker
}
// Fetch stats from Twitter and store it for display by the web interface.
func fetchStats(api *anaconda.TwitterApi) error {
handles := strings.Join(democrats, ",") + "," + strings.Join(republicans, ",")
users, err := api.GetUsersLookup(handles, url.Values{})
if err != nil {
return err
}
t := make([]TwitterInfo, len(users))
for i, u := range users {
t[i].Name = u.Name
t[i].Image = u.ProfileImageURL
t[i].Followers = u.FollowersCount
t[i].Tweets = u.StatusesCount
for _, d := range democrats {
if u.ScreenName == d {
t[i].Democrat = true
break
}
}
}
sort.Sort(ByFollowers(t))
stats.Put(t)
return nil
}
func main() {
log.SetFlags(0)
// Load ET time zone
TZ_ET, _ = time.LoadLocation("America/New_York")
// Init the Twitter API
anaconda.SetConsumerKey(CONSUMER_KEY)
anaconda.SetConsumerSecret(CONSUMER_SECRET)
api := anaconda.NewTwitterApi(ACCESS_TOKEN, ACCESS_TOKEN_SECRET)
// Fetch it once
if err := fetchStats(api);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
// Start the web interface
go startWeb()
// Keep updating the stats every minute
for {
time.Sleep(time.Minute)
fetchStats(api)
}
}
